Availability – here’s what’s actually essential. The most essential thing is that accessibility can not be automated.
WCAG 2.0 AA has actually been commonly referenced by the Department of Justice and in courts in deciding whether a website is accessible. So it’s not that WCAG is the law however it is a guiding force in what constitutes ease of access and whether- no matter- whether it’s a AccessiBe or another overlay vendor they all stop working. They don’t really comply with these- to WCAG. So they don’t comply with the standards – even if they say they do, we can with no hesitation prove that they do not. Automation
All of the three accessibility services, EqualWeb, AudioEye, and AccessiBe, have an unique place for automation in their accessibility service package. At EqualWeb, ease of access audit is and is a totally free service managed by Google Chrome software application specifically dedicated to that function. With AudioEye, you can count on the complimentary Home builder Chrome extension to direct you on repairing available errors on your site after you may have run an automated WCAG screening. While AccessiBe, through its free accessibility scanning platform, aCe, likewise offers an equal measure of automation to begin the compliance journey.
Handbook Availability
EqualWeb is a totally hybrid accessibility option with provisions for both extremes of automation and manual availability. Instead of counting on the AI-powered audit, you can ask for EqualWeb’s ease of access contingent to carry out an audit analysis. Called site accessibility audit of your site content, structure, and design templates at a customized cost. Similarly, there is an option for a manual accessibility monitoring strategy which is much more expensive than the automated remediation solution however safer because it is dealt with by specialists. So, it is very possible to blend automation with manual effort or elect one at the exclusion of the other when you pick EqualWeb. Mellanox Nvidia
AudioEye, by the same token, provides an appropriate option to automated software application in its Managed plan. AudioEye’s Managed strategy not only gives you access to its innovative ease of access toolbar but likewise enlists the assistance of AudioEye’s expert team to carry out the audit and remediation of your site. Basically, it is a do-it-for-me alternative.
You would recall that AccessiBe is a completely automated ease of access service. There is no provision for manual input. All hopes are anchored on AI and machine learning. Thinking about the untold advantage of manual proficiency to AI-powered solutions, not having arrangements for manual input might be a big minus on the part of AccessiBe. Thus, from the very beginning, AccessiBe may discover it tough to take on EqualWeb and AudioEye which are both hybrid solutions.

EqualWeb Rates
EqualWeb offers a mouth-watering free strategy that consists of close to half of the functions on an average availability toolbar. It makes it possible to perform an automated evaluation of the website as well as delight in fundamental tools in the ease of access widget.
For its Availability Monitoring, which is more of a handled plan that enlists the knowledge of EqualWeb’s ease of access group, the cost begins at $590 annually for a standard site of up 100 pages and could cost as much as $9990 each year (manual) accessibility tracking of up 100,000 pages.
